In order for an Retail Food Establishment license to be issued, the following must be completed:
1) Provide documentation that the grease interceptor has been service and inspected by a licensed plumber.
2) Provide documentation that the main backflow prevention device has been tested and functional.
3) Provide documentation from building department regarding the approval of alterations to the Ansel system.
4) The hood system shall be professionally cleaned.
5) Repair the missing and damaged tiles on the front pass through counter. Surfaces shall be smooth, durable and easily cleanable.
6) Thoroughly clean the floors, walls, ceilings equipment (inside and out) to be "brand new" clean.
7) Provide hot-water (100 degrees F) at the hand washing sink in the employee restroom.
8) Provide a sign on front door regarding no public rest-rooms.
9) Paper towels, soap, hand washing signage (employees much wash hands) shall be provided at each hand sink.
10) Re attach the sink vanity to wall in rest-room.
11) Outdoor grease container shall be installed on the concrete pad.
12) Refuse dumpster concrete pad is cracked and damaged. Plan to have this replaced at some point.
13) Provide documentation verifying the training of the employees regarding the reporting their health issues to the PIC.
14) Provide a signed application (provided for you at the next inspection) and license fee for the amount of $500.
15) If any foods or sauces are to be processed at the Brown Street location in Akron, the Akron location shall registered with the Ohio Department of Agriculture to be a processing location.

This is not a final list. List is subject to change upon further review of the facility.
